Frequently asked questions

What's Piding like for family-friendly holidays?
The destination of Piding is a good option if you've been considering a getaway with the children. There are some interesting activities that the entire family might enjoy. Arrange a flight into Salzburg (SZG-W.A. Mozart), which is located 4.2 mi (6.8 km) from the city centre.
When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Piding?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 0°C. The snowiest months in Piding are December, January, November and February, with each month seeing an average of 13 cm of snowfall.
What's there to see and do with your family in Piding?
Hangar-7 and Europark Shopping Center are interesting attractions that you and your family may enjoy exploring while you are staying in Piding. Make sure that you have lots of time for activities such as Getreidegasse and Mozart's Birthplace.
What's the best way for us to get around Piding?
If you want to explore the larger area, hop on a train at Piding Station. Piding may not have many public transport options to choose from, so consider renting a car to explore more.
